@Component
public class ResourceEventListenerImpl implements ResourceEventListener {
private static final Trace LOGGER = TraceManager.getTrace(ResourceEventListenerImpl.class);
@Autowired(required = true)
private ShadowCacheFactory shadowCacheFactory;
@Autowired(required = true)
private ProvisioningContextFactory provisioningContextFactory;
@Autowired
private ChangeNotificationDispatcher notificationManager;
@PostConstruct
public void registerForResourceObjectChangeNotifications() {
notificationManager.registerNotificationListener(this);
}
@PreDestroy
public void unregisterForResourceObjectChangeNotifications() {
notificationManager.unregisterNotificationListener(this);
}
private ShadowCache getShadowCache(ShadowCacheFactory.Mode mode){
return shadowCacheFactory.getShadowCache(mode);
}
@Override
public String getName() {
// TODO Auto-generated method stub
return null;
}
@Override
public void notifyEvent(ResourceEventDescription eventDescription, Task task, OperationResult parentResult) throws SchemaException, CommunicationException, ConfigurationException, SecurityViolationException, ObjectNotFoundException, GenericConnectorException, ObjectAlreadyExistsException {
Validate.notNull(eventDescription, "Event description must not be null.");
Validate.notNull(task, "Task must not be null.");
Validate.notNull(parentResult, "Operation result must not be null");
LOGGER.trace("Received event notification with the description: {}", eventDescription.debugDump());
if (eventDescription.getCurrentShadow() == null && eventDescription.getDelta() == null){
throw new IllegalStateException("Neither current shadow, nor delta specified. It is required to have at least one of them specified.");
}
applyDefinitions(eventDescription, parentResult);
PrismObject<ShadowType> shadow = null;
shadow = eventDescription.getShadow();
ShadowCache shadowCache = getShadowCache(Mode.STANDARD);
ProvisioningContext ctx = provisioningContextFactory.create(shadow, task, parentResult);
ctx.assertDefinition();
Collection<ResourceAttribute<?>> identifiers = ShadowUtil.getPrimaryIdentifiers(shadow);
Change change = new Change(identifiers, eventDescription.getCurrentShadow(), eventDescription.getOldShadow(), eventDescription.getDelta());
ObjectClassComplexTypeDefinition objectClassDefinition = ShadowUtil.getObjectClassDefinition(shadow);
change.setObjectClassDefinition(objectClassDefinition);
ShadowType shadowType = shadow.asObjectable();
LOGGER.trace("Start to precess change: {}", change.toString());
shadowCache.processChange(ctx, change, null, parentResult);
LOGGER.trace("Change after processing {} . Start synchronizing.", change.toString());
shadowCache.processSynchronization(ctx, change, parentResult);
}
private void applyDefinitions(ResourceEventDescription eventDescription,
OperationResult parentResult) throws SchemaException, ObjectNotFoundException, CommunicationException, ConfigurationException {
ShadowCache shadowCache = getShadowCache(Mode.STANDARD);
if (eventDescription.getCurrentShadow() != null){
shadowCache.applyDefinition(eventDescription.getCurrentShadow(), parentResult);
}
if (eventDescription.getOldShadow() != null){
shadowCache.applyDefinition(eventDescription.getOldShadow(), parentResult);
}
if (eventDescription.getDelta() != null){
shadowCache.applyDefinition(eventDescription.getDelta(), null, parentResult);
}
}
}
